    REVIEW OF ROCK BRITTLENESS EVALUATION METHODS AND DISCUSSION ON THEIR ADAPTABILITIES

    • Brittleness is one of the most important mechanical properties of rock materials. Accurate evaluation of rock brittleness has extremely high practical value and plays a crucial role in underground engineering and slope stability,rock drillability and cutability analysis in water conservancy,hydropower,transportation,energy exploration and development. Researchers from all over the world have established many brittleness evaluation indexes from physical parameters,mechanical parameters,and elastic parameters. However,there is no unified recognition and definition of rock brittleness yet. This article systematically reviews the methods of rock brittleness evaluation at home and abroad,classifies dozens of commonly used brittleness evaluation indicators,summarizes the basic principles and application status of existing brittleness indicators,and discusses the adaptability,advantages and existing problems of brittleness indicators. Finally,the future research direction of rock brittleness evaluation method is discussed.
